Too many anchor text words
Some experts have actually pointed out these blogs to be “anchor text spam.” What do I mean by this? Think about those blogs which seem to have too many links within the posts. Now, let me make it clear that links within blog posts are very important. They help readers get more information without having to search for it themselves. But then, blogs that have an excess of such links within anchor texts are irritating.
I am sure that there are some bloggers who may not be aware that they are providing too many links and anchor text in their post. Perhaps their idea is to offer as much assistance to their readers as they can – by providing the links to as many sources of information as they can. This does not have to be the case, though. Imagine reading through a 250-word post and having 10 links!
I suggest that you provide 2 or 3 links which are of the highest importance in relation to your post. That should be enough to provide your readers with the necessary information.
